Price in the local bullion market up by Rs429 per 10 grams


Karachi: Owing to the international market, the gold price has increased in Pakistan on Wednesday.
The price of the precious metal rose by Rs500 per tola and Rs429 per 10 grams to settle at Rs127,150 and Rs109,011, respectively.
Gold dealers said that due to a lack of purchasing power, there is no demand in the local market.
In the international market, gold recorded a slight increase of $7 per ounce to settle at $1,845 as investors sought the safety of bullion amid the Ukraine-Russia crisis, with strength in the US dollar weighing on the metal ahead of an imminent rate hike by the US Federal Reserve.
Meanwhile, silver prices in the domestic market remained unchanged at Rs1,470 per tola and Rs1,260.28 per 10 grams today.
